How our inventory plays a part to help you.

Not only do we own, and operate all of our equipment here at G2G, but we always stock 

"excess inventory" to ensure fast turn around times, and last minute changes in product 

demands. Stocking excess raw inventory is something basically unheard of anymore in 

manufacturing, as unused inventory is considered an unnecessary, and costly expense. 

Without getting too far into the details here:

this "bean counter" type of thinking is just a time bomb waiting to go off on the business, 

and therefore, our customer as well, as we then put ourselves in the position of relying on

our supply chain to deliver on time every time, so that we can meet our customer demands.

"No way" we say! In the "real world" it only costs Approx. one to two cents per unit to 

ensure that we have complete control over our ability to satisfy all of our customer needs.
